我知道默认情况下,元素分为块级元素和内联元素。换句话说,this post中提到的元素(包括body元素)默认具有CSS display:block属性。然而,this post中提到的元素默认显示:inline属性。
<小时/> 问题是,在组织文档结构时,避免修改默认样式是否是好的做法,而是坚持使用用户代理设置的样式。另外,除了语义之外,是否有理由避免将元素(例如内联斜体元素)重新定义为完全自定义元素?
答案 0 :(得分:1)
遵循您想要的语义和风格的最佳做法。
语义赋予标记意义。风格让它看起来如你所愿。